Slow Cooker Tamale Pie

(from Taste of Home)

8 Servings

Prep: 25 min.

Cook: 7 hours

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on pepper
  • 1 can (15 ounces) black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 can (14-1/2 ounces) diced tomatoes with mild green chilies, undrained
  • 1 can (11 ounces) whole kernel corn, drained
  • 1 can (10 ounces) enchilada sauce
  • 2 green onions, chopped
  • 1/4 cup minced fresh cilantro
  • 1 package (8-1/2 ounces) corn bread/muffin mix
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 cup (4 ounces) shredded Mexican cheese blend
  • Sour cream and additional minced fresh cilantro, optional

Directions

- In a large skillet, cook beef over medium heat until no longer pink; drain.

- Stir in the cumin, salt, chili powder and pepper.

- Transfer to a 4-qt. slow cooker; stir in the beans, tomatoes, corn, enchilada sauce, onions and cilantro.

-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or until heated through.

- In a small bowl, combine muffin mix and eggs; spoon over meat mixture. Cover and cook 1 hour longer or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ean.

- Sprinkle with cheese; cover and let stand for 5 minutes. Serve with sour cream and additional cilantro if desired.

Alesha’s thoughts:

This turned out really good. I only made one change: I omitted the cilantro because I don’t buy it. It goes to waste around my house. My husband doesn’t share my love of Mexican food, so he wasn’t as crazy about it as I was. I really liked it; the kids ate everything but the cornbread topping. But my kids are weird like that – they don’t really like bread. I think I will make this again, but since it requires the cornbread mix poured in an hour before serving, this will not make my Sunday lunch recipe collection.
